Method for removing image color noise, method for removing video color noise and related devices

A color noise and image technology, applied in the field of image processing, can solve problems such as color distortion and achieve the effect of reducing loss

Active Publication Date: 2020-09-11
BIGO TECH PTE LTD
View PDF4 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] Embodiments of the present invention provide a method for removing color noise in an image, a method for removing color noise in a video, and related devices, so as to solve the problem in the prior art that color distortion is caused to light spots or thin lines with color information while removing color noise

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for removing image color noise, method for removing video color noise and related devices
  • Method for removing image color noise, method for removing video color noise and related devices
  • Method for removing image color noise, method for removing video color noise and related devices

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0043] figure 1 It is a flow chart of steps for a method for removing color noise in an image provided by Embodiment 1 of the present invention. This embodiment of the present invention is applicable to the situation of removing color noise in an image. The method can be implemented by the device for removing color noise in an image according to the embodiment of the present invention To implement, the device for removing image color noise can be implemented by hardware or software, and integrated in the electronic device provided by the embodiment of the present invention, specifically, such as figure 1 As shown, the method for removing image color noise in the embodiment of the present invention may include the following steps:

[0044] S101. Acquire an ambient light brightness value when an image is captured.

[0045] In an example of the embodiment of the present invention, the ambient light brightness value of the shooting scene can be detected by the light sensor on the...

Embodiment 2

[0056] Figure 2A It is a flow chart of the steps of a method for removing image color noise provided by Embodiment 2 of the present invention. The embodiment of the present invention is optimized on the basis of the foregoing Embodiment 1. Specifically, as Figure 2A As shown, the method for removing image color noise in the embodiment of the present invention may include the following steps:

[0057] S201. Acquire an ambient light brightness value when an image is captured.

[0058] S202. Perform filtering processing on the brightness value of the image to obtain a filtered brightness value of the image.

[0059] Optionally, in this embodiment of the present invention, the image has three channels of data Y, U, and V, where Y is a brightness value, and the Y channel can be filtered to obtain the brightness value of the filtered image. Specifically, it can be Use 3DNR (3DDenoising, 3D denoising) to remove the noise of the Y channel. 3DNR compares the images of the two frame...

Embodiment 3

[0106] image 3 It is a flow chart of the steps of a method for removing color noise in video provided by Embodiment 3 of the present invention. This embodiment of the present invention is applicable to the situation of removing color noise in video. device, the device for removing video color noise can be implemented by hardware or software, and integrated in the electronic device provided by the embodiment of the present invention, specifically, as image 3 As shown, the method for removing video color noise in the embodiment of the present invention may include the following steps:

[0107] S301. Capture video data in response to a user operation.

[0108] In the embodiment of the present invention, the shooting device is provided with a light sensor, which can be used to detect the ambient light brightness value of the shooting scene that the shooting device is facing. Smart phones, smart tablets, personal electronic digital assistants, etc. with light sensors, and elect...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The embodiment of the invention discloses a method for removing image color noise, a method for removing video color noise and related devices. The method for removing image color noise comprises thefollowing steps: acquiring an ambient light brightness value when an image is shot; when the ambient light brightness value is smaller than a preset threshold value, guiding and filtering the chrominance value of the target pixel point according to the ambient light brightness value and the brightness value of the filtering window, and obtaining the brightness absolute error sum of the filtering window and the initial chrominance value of the target pixel point; calculating a target chromaticity value of the target pixel point based on the ambient light brightness value, the brightness absolute error sum, the initial chromaticity value and the original chromaticity value; and adjusting the chrominance value of the target pixel point to enable the adjusted chrominance value to be equal to the target chrominance value so as to remove color noise. Since the ambient light brightness value can perform prior estimation on the color noise level of the image, the chrominance loss caused by filtering is reduced, the brightness value of the filtering window is used for filtering, the original chrominance value is used for adjusting the initial chrominance value, and the chrominance of a non-color-noise area is protected while color noise is removed.

Description

technical field [0001] Embodiments of the present invention relate to the technical field of image processing, and in particular, to a method for removing color noise in an image, a method for removing color noise in a video, and related devices. Background technique [0002] In the scene of video shooting or image shooting, the camera will produce obvious blocky color noise in the captured image or video in the scene where the ambient light is relatively dark. On the one hand, it has a negative impact on the video or image encoding and compression process, increasing the cost of data transmission. [0003] In order to obtain an image with better quality, it is necessary to remove the color noise in the image. In the prior art, filtering is usually used to remove the color noise. In order to reduce the impact on the non-noise area in the image based on the filtering denoising algorithm, various edge-preserving filtering algorithms are usually used, such as bilateral filteri...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04N9/64
CPCH04N9/646
Inventor 杨敏
Owner BIGO TECH PTE L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products